Sunday was an extra special, celebratory day for Jack Black and his wife Tanya Haden.
On Sunday, February 22, the School of Rock actor and the musician rang in their milestone 20th anniversary, marking two decades since their elopement.
To commemorate the special day, Jack, 56, took to Instagram and shared a heartfelt tribute to Tanya, 54, along with photos of the two throughout the years.
The first of the photos sees them in an embrace looking intently at each other, and next Jack shared a photo of the pair meditating with their two sons, Samuel, 19, and Thomas, 17.

Tanya, who is originally from New York, is a cellist and vocalist. Her father is the late jazz bassist Charlie Haden, and along with her sisters Rachel and Petra, who she is triplets with, she had a band called That Dog, plus they also performed as The Haden Triplets.
She received an MFA degree from California Institute of the Arts, where she majored in experimental animation, and has recorded with several LA-based bands.
Though Tanya and Jack didnât start dating until 2005, when they were in their early 30s, they actually first crossed paths over a decade prior to that, when both went to the famed Santa Monica private school Crossroads, where the likes of Kate Hudson, Gwyneth Paltrow, Jonah Hill, Maya Rudolph, and Sean Astin, among others, also went.
Speaking to Parade in 2015, Jack confessed: âI didnât date Tanya or talk to her or anything in high school,â adding: âI was pretty shy. I just watched her from afar. We only started dating like 20 years after high school.â
Though Tanya and Jack took almost 20 years to reconnect after knowing each other in high school, it didnât take long for them to tie the knot. The two started dating in March 2005, and eloped in March of the following year with a private ceremony in Big Sur, California.
They keep their sons â the firstborn named in honor of Sammy Davis Jr. and the youngest after Jackâs first name, Thomas â largely out of the spotlight. Jack, weighing in on whether either of them will follow in their dadâs footsteps, told Parade in 2023: âIâm not going to pressure them in any certain direction. I just like them to follow their passion and do what theyâre interested in.â
